Healthwatch East Sussex Hosts it 2023 Annual Event

On the 13th July 2023, Healthwatch East Sussex Hosted its 2023 Annual Event, at The View Hotel, Eastbourne.
It was great to see so many people in attendance. We were joined by members of the public and our colleagues from statutory and voluntary organisations.
Many thanks to all those who attended, and we hope that you found the event useful and enjoyed it as much as we did.
It was great to be able to share our achievements from the last 10 years and to share our plans for the future, as well as to receive feedback and engage in lively discussions about health and care in East Sussex.
The event included 5 key speakers who presented on the theme of “Your Voice Counts: Celebrating 10 years of Healthwatch”:
- Sarah Russell – Assistant Director, Adult Social Care & Health, East Sussex County Council
- Lou Carter – Assistant Director, Communications, Planning & Performance, Children’s Services, East Sussex County Council.
- Richard Milner – Chief of Staff, East Sussex NHS Healthcare Trust
- Jennifer Twist – Chief Executive, Care for the Carers
- Louise Ansari – Chief Executive of Healthwatch England.
Copies of the speaker presentations can be downloaded here.
Discussion groups
Following the speakers presentation there were discussion groups including attendees from a range of organisations and locations. They were tasked with developing responses to each of the following questions:
Q1. How can we ensure public and patient voice is at the heart of local decision-making [in health and care]?
Q2. How well do health and care services ‘listen’ to local people and service users?
Q3. What practical suggestions do you have to encourage and enable people to share their health and care experiences?
Q4. What three issues should Healthwatch East Sussex prioritise in our work for the next 12 months?
